1 OVERVIEW
Video processor (VP) is responsible for video scaling, de-interlacing, & video post processing of TV-out data path.
VP reads reconstructed YCbCr 4:2:0 video sequences from DRAM, processes the sequence, and sends it to
MIXER on-the-fly as shown in Figure 9.8-1.
1.1 FEATURES
Input YCbCr sequence of VP is up to 1280x720@60Hz. Basic features of VP are as follows:
•
Supported Image Specification
♦ BOB / 2D TILE (YUV420 NV12 type, Note : refer to MFC user's manual for 2D TILE)
♦ Input source size up to 1280x720 (min : 32x4)
•
Produce YCbCr 4:4:4 outputs to help MIXER to blend video and graphics
•
Supports 1/4X to 16X vertical scaling with 4-tap/16-phase poly-phase filter
•
Supports 1/4X to 16X horizontal scaling with 8-tap/16-phase poly-phase filter
•
Supports Pan & Scan, Letterbox, and NTSC/PAL conversion using scaling
•
Supports Flexible scaled video positioning within display area
•
Supports 1/16 pixel resolution Pan&Scan mode
•
Supports Flexible post video processing
♦ Color saturation, Brightness/Contrast enhancement, Edge enhancement
♦
Color space conversion between BT.601 and BT.709
